School Overview

Dade County High School is a public school located in Trenton, Georgia. It is a school in Dade County School District district.

According to the Georgia state assessment result, 32% of students are proficient in Math learning and about 47% of students are proficient in English/language arts learning.

It has 572 students through grade 9 to 12. The students to teacher ratio is 14 to 1 where a total of 41 teachers are teaching for the school.

Teachers & Staffs

Total 41 full-time (or equivalent) teachers work for Dade County High School and the students to teacher ratio is 14 to 1. 82.9% of teachers are certified. 90.2% of teachers have 3 or more years teaching experiences.

Advanced Placement Programs

Dade County High School offers 5 advanced placement (AP) programs. Total 139 students are enrolled in at least one (1) AP programs. 123 students are participating the SAT and/or ACT test program at Dade County High School.
